学习目标:
模拟红绿灯,红灯亮十秒,绿灯亮五秒,交替,并用波形图将波形显示
开始编写:
前面板
两个指示灯,一个红色,一个绿色,一个波形图;
程序框图
创建一个for循环,次数随意,添加一个移位寄存器,初始值为布尔假,每次循环都用传给下一循环;
添加一个等待函数,取移位寄存器的值选择等待时间,一个10000,一个5000,如果等于10000则红灯为真,绿灯为假;
红绿灯状态创建数组,转换为数字,建立通道传给波形图;
运行看看效果;
模拟红绿灯,红灯亮十秒,绿灯亮五秒,交替,并用波形图将波形显示
两个指示灯,一个红色,一个绿色,一个波形图;
创建一个for循环,次数随意,添加一个移位寄存器,初始值为布尔假,每次循环都用传给下一循环;
添加一个等待函数,取移位寄存器的值选择等待时间,一个10000,一个5000,如果等于10000则红灯为真,绿灯为假;
红绿灯状态创建数组,转换为数字,建立通道传给波形图;
运行看看效果;